Subject: Re: [PATCH] sched: idle: move need_resched check after function
 rcu_idle_enter

On Sat, Nov 21, 2015 at 01:02:02AM -0800, Lianwei Wang wrote:
> The rcu_idle_endter may call wakeup_softirqd to set the need resched
> flag on idle process. But if we don't check it after that, then the
> cpu will enter idle state with RESCHED flag set and can not be woken
> up by wakeup/resched call anymore.

Fair enough; but which cpuidle driver did you observe that with? All the
ones I checked test for need_resched again after this.
